Trans cooler Location

Im getting a trans cooler soon and im looking for the most efficient place to put it. putting it behind the radiator like the box says seems to me to kind of defeat the purpose. does anyone have any ideas on what a good spot would be? thanks guys.

The box says to put it behind the radiator?? Weird. You're right, that's the worst spot. A better spot is between the a/c condensor and the radiator. The best spot is where I've got mine; in front of the radiator.

mines in front of the radiator, the fan blows air in the cooler and into the radiator plus the other fan pulls air in thru the cooler and radiator
